The history of philosophy is beset by unresolved disputes. These disputes are passed down from generation to generation as problems to be solved. If not solved, they engender skepticism. Philosophical disputes, posed as problems, can be resolved or dissolved if we first acknowledge that some things are clear to reason. Philosophical problems are about beliefs. There are more basic and less basic beliefs. All philosophical problems can be resolved by critical analysis of basic beliefs. What is basic is clear to reason. Basic beliefs are about God and man and good and evil. A historical, critical analysis of philosophical problems reveals what a thinker believes about reason, God, man, and the good for man. Not all basic beliefs are coherent when tested by the critical use of reason. A critical analysis of basic beliefs should lead us to see what is clear.
